Noises During Shifting problems of the 2003 Chevrolet Silverado

Three problems related to noises during shifting have been reported for the 2003 Chevrolet Silverado. The most recently reported issues are listed below.

1 Noises During Shifting problem

Failure Date: 03/22/2005

When shifting from the second to third gear a loud banging noise was produced. Dealer has rebuilt the transmission. C urrently, when shifting first gear to second gear a loud noise is produced. Consumer is concerned that the transmission will fail while driving.

2 Noises During Shifting problem

Failure Date: 02/16/2004

Transmission slips between dead stop to second gear-more noticeable when wheel is turned. "clunking" noise when shifting. Dealer was unable to find anything wrong. (2003-2500hd crew).

3 Noises During Shifting problem

Failure Date: 12/22/2003

I am complaining of a clunking sound and a hard shift coming from the transmission in a 2-3 upshift in a 03 Silverado automatic. I have taken it to the dealer many times and they tell me that gm says the noise and shifting is normal. I have driven many cars and nothing I have driven shifts like that. I wish gm would have to do a recall and correct the problem.
